The size of Surry Hills is approximately 1.3 square kilometres. There are 17 parks, covering nearly 9.2% of the total area. The population of Surry Hills in 2016 was 16412 people. By 2021 the population was 15828 showing a population decline of 3.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Surry Hills is 30-39 years. Households in Surry Hills are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Surry Hills work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 32.20% of the homes in Surry Hills were owner-occupied compared with 32.30% in 2016.
